Vertical Gardening Ideas
Vertical gardening is a creative way to make the most of limited space. Here are some ideas to inspire your urban garden:
1. Wall-Mounted Planters
Attach wall-mounted planters to your balcony or fence to grow herbs, flowers, or small vegetables vertically.

2. Hanging Baskets
Suspend hanging baskets from your ceiling or balcony railing to add greenery without taking up floor space.

3. Vertical Garden Towers
Vertical garden towers are freestanding structures that allow you to plant a variety of crops in a small footprint.

4. Trellises and Arbors
Use trellises or arbors to support climbing plants like tomatoes, cucumbers, or beans, saving space and adding visual interest.
